Nurturing Nature's Bounty: A Beginner's Guide to Organic Food Growing

Have you ever dreamt concerning cultivating your own organic garden? It's a rewarding experience that connects you directly with nature and yields delicious harvests. Whether you are a complete beginner or own some gardening skill, this guide will provide the essential instructions to get you started on your organic farming journey.

  • Begin with choosing a sunny location for your garden that receives at least six hours of sunlight each day.
  • Prepare the soil by adding organic matter to improve its fertility and drainage.
  • Select non-GMO seeds or seedlings that are suitable for your climate and soil type.
  • Sow your seeds or seedlings according to the instructions on their packaging.
  • Hydrate your plants regularly, especially during harsh weather.

Remove unwanted growth regularly to prevent competition for nutrients and sunlight.

Inspect your plants for any signs of pests or diseases and take appropriate steps to control them organically.
